How Apex Legends Weapon Tiers are Determined

This weapon tier list evaluates four categories: raw time-to-kill against purple armor, versatility across different engagements, ease of use, and pick-rate data from the game's ranked lobbies. Care package weapons in Apex Legends are weighed differently because they are much harder to acquire and will need to justify that they are worth the extra effort. Hop-up synergy also weighed heavily.

S Tier

The R-301 Carbine stands as the undisputed king of versatility, delivering consistent damage with manageable recoil across all engagement ranges. The Peacekeeper dominates close-quarters combat with devastating burst damage that can eliminate enemies in two well-placed shots. Flatline brings heavy assault rifle damage with excellent range capabilities, while the Wingman rewards skilled players with high-damage precision shots.

The Volt SMG rounds out this elite tier with exceptional close-range performance, offering superior damage output and controllable recoil that makes it deadly in aggressive pushes. These five weapons represent the pinnacle of reliability and effectiveness in competitive Apex Legends gameplay.

A Tier

The R-99 delivers lightning-fast time-to-kill in close quarters but demands precise aim and recoil control to maximize its potential. Hemlok provides excellent burst-fire damage for mid-range engagements, while the RE-45 serves as a surprisingly effective secondary weapon with minimal recoil.

Longbow DMR excels at long-range engagements with high damage per shot, and the Triple Take offers versatility as both a shotgun and sniper depending on choke attachment. These weapons perform exceptionally well in their specialized roles but lack the universal applicability of S-tier options.

B Tier

The Mastiff delivers solid shotgun performance but requires precise positioning to outshine the Peacekeeper. Devotion brings devastating damage output when fully spun up, though its wind-up time creates vulnerability windows. Both EVA-8 variants provide reliable close-range options with faster fire rates than other shotguns, making them forgiving for newer players.

The Spitfire offers sustained damage with a massive magazine, excelling in suppression roles but lacking the burst potential of higher-tier weapons. The 30-30 Repeater rounds out this tier with decent mid-range capabilities, though it struggles to compete with more specialized marksman weapons. These weapons are solid choices that can perform well in the right hands and situations.

C Tier

HAVOC struggles with energy ammo scarcity and lengthy charge times despite decent damage potential. The Akimbo Mozambique offers improved close-range performance but remains situational. L-STAR EMG, Charge Rifle, and Sentinel provide niche utility but lack the consistency needed for higher tier placement in the current meta.

D Tier

The P2020 sits alone in the bottom tier as the weakest weapon in Apex Legends. While it can serve as an emergency backup weapon in the early game, its low damage output and poor scaling make it virtually unusable in serious engagements.

Players should prioritize replacing the P2020 as quickly as possible, as even basic weapons from higher tiers will provide significantly better combat effectiveness. Its only redeeming quality is availability, but this advantage disappears rapidly as better options become accessible.
